OPPORTUNITY:
Looking for a BC/BE Pulmonologist to join our outpatient Pulmonary and Critical Care practice.
COMPENSATION:
- Option #1: Base salary of $372,730 (50%tile MGMA for those just completing training) with additional compensation for experience, guaranteed for two years. Can be switched to a wRVU production contract when exceeding target.
- Option #2: Base salary of $441,480 (75%tile MGMA) guaranteed for one year and then switched to a wRVU production contract.
* 5% less for those not yet boarded, salary adjusted accordingly upon board certification
2-Year contract also includes:
- Vacation: 4 Weeks plus holidays/sick days (29 PTO days). Additional 5 days when producing 75%tile wRVUs
- CME/Books & Journals: 5 days PTO and up to $5000
- Medical School Loan Repayment: repay up to $200,000 ($25,000 per year for each year of service commitment)
- Deferred compensation: 457b plan. Defer compensation up to IRS limit of $19,500 year before taxes. No matching.
- Retirement / Savings Plan: 403b plan. Defer compensation up to IRS limit of $19,500 year before taxes under age 50 and $24,000 for over age 50. SOMC matches dollar for dollar up to 2% of base pay.
- Moving Expense: $10,000 paid to moving company
- Malpractice Insurance Coverage: in a claims made insurance, in an amount of $1,000,000, per claim/$3,000,000, aggregate
- Health Insurance: provider pays small premium, deducted from paycheck
- Liquidated Damages: 70 mile and 2-year non-compete clause or liquidated damages of one year salary
- Sign-on Bonus:15% of base salary up to $100,000 (paid when contract signed and forgiven over 2 years)
- Residency Stipend: up to $25,000 (requires up to 2-year service commitment)
- Bonus Incentives: excellent bonus incentives up to 30% of salary

- Case Load
- Office: 15-20 patients/day
- Inpatient: dictated by hospital census
- Procedures as scheduled
- Mixed pulmonary inpatient/outpatient assisted by advanced practitioners/PA
- Possibility of critical care coverage-rare
- Inpatient and outpatient procedure to include all pulmonary diagnostic and therapeutic procedures:
- Bronchoscopy diagnostic procedures-BAL, brushing, transbronchial needle aspiration, transbronchial forcep biopsy
- If skilled in advanced bronchoscopy (navigational bronchoscopy and endobronchial ultrasound peripheral and central)
- Thoracentesis/chest tube placement-percutaneous and open
- Tracheostomy management
- Laryngoscopy may be performed in office
- Point of care ultrasound in office and in hospital
- Shared responsibility for dictation of pulmonary function testing and cardiopulmonary stress testing
